How much do simulation support engineer jobs pay per year?

As of Sep 11, 2026, the average yearly pay for simulation support engineer in the United States is $123,399.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$92,000.00 and $146,500.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

Roles:

  • Assist existing customers on operation and use of AST software
  • Technical sales support of customers including model setup, execution and analysis
  • Evaluation of customer requirements including estimation of scope
  • Organize local and customer-site training courses
  • Maintain and update training material and handouts
  • Reporting and communication of customer feedback to appropriate local and Graz AST staff
  • Project management and execution for AST simulation customer programs
  • Business development support including pre-sales activities (presentations, product demonstrations)
  • Customer evaluation support: proactively manage product evaluations by 1) leading initial training courses, 2) continuous follow-up during evaluation period, 3) post-evaluation analysis
  • Explore software functions proactively when support load permits and devise guides that will assist users and other support engineers to become more familiar and confident with the product and it interfaces
  • Works independently on common tasks and for new and advanced tasks works with senior support staffย 

Qualifications/Skills:

  • Bachelor's degree in Engineering
  • Master's degree preferred
  • 5+ years of experience in simulation / analysis / math-based simulation tools
  • Strong background in powertrain and vehicle component modeling and design optimization
  • Positive, customer-focused attitude
  • Understanding of vehicle systems, including advanced technologies
  • Excellent written and oral communication skills
